Body

Origins and Family

Luis Caffarelli was born in Buenos Aires[2]. He was born on +1948-12-08T00:00:00Z[3].

Education

Educated at University of Buenos Aires[16], a public university[28], in Argentina[29], founded in 1821[30] and National School of Buenos Aires[17], a secondary school[31], in Argentina[32], founded in 1863[33]. Luis Caffarelli's doctoral advisor was Calixto Pedro Calderón[18]. He earned the academic degree of Doctor of Sciences in Physics and Mathematics[34].

Career and Affiliations

Recorded occupations include mathematician[4] and university teacher[5]. Fields of work include mathematical analysis[10], an academic discipline[35] and partial differential equation[11]. Employers include University of Texas at Austin[12], a public research university[36], in United States[37], founded in 1883[38], headquartered in Austin[39]; New York University[13], a private university[40], in United States[41], founded in 1831[42], headquartered in New York City[43]; University of Chicago[14], a private university[44], in United States[45], founded in 1890[46], headquartered in Chicago[47]; and University of Minnesota[15], a public research university[48], in United States[49], founded in 1851[50], headquartered in Minneapolis[51]. Doctoral students include Ovidiu Savin[52], Eduardo Teixeira[53], Ioannis Athanasopoulos[54], Enrico Valdinoci[55], Guido De Philippis[56], and Daniel Phillips[57].

Recognition

Awards received include Bôcher Memorial Prize[19], a science award[58], in United States[59], founded in 1923[60]; Wolf Prize in Mathematics[20], a science award[61], in Israel[62], founded in 1978[63]; Rolf Schock Prize in Mathematics[21], a science award[64], founded in 1993[65]; diamond Konex award[22], an award[66], in Argentina[67]; Fellow of the Society for Industrial and Applied Mathematics[23], a fellowship award[68]; and The Shaw Prize in Mathematical Sciences[24], a science award[69].

Personal Life

Among Luis Caffarelli's spouses was Irene M. Gamba[7].
